To be honest, as a businessman, I'm actually kinda bemused by the stories of people who are adamant about throwing away slipcovers/slipboxes/slipcases, since I don't care how other people organize their collections. I'm pleased that all my 4Ks and Shout stuff have slips, but let's say for the sake of argument that I didn't care about my slips and thought my collection looked its best without any slips. Would I throw them out? Of course not, because looking at the market shows it's not good business sense to do so, especially in a genre with passionate collectors like horror, and even more so especially for a boutique label whose consumers are even more likely to have the collector mindset. So what would I do? I'd look at eBay right now and note the insane prices people will pay for slips (even unofficial custom ones have multiple bidders), take them off my copies, flatten them out, put them in a shoebox in the closet instead of in the trash, and forget about them. Then I'd wait however long it takes for the slips to go OOP and for people online to start grumbling about it, take them out of the box, and list them. In the process, given the going rates, I could probably sell many of the slips for the same prices I bought the whole blu-ray for initially, essentially meaning that, retroactively, I would've gotten these releases for free, or at least for pennies on the dollar.

Like, I understand why someone might not care about throwing out a dime-a-dozen super mainstream slip that might, at most, go for like $5 down the line because everyone got it and it's harder to find a slipless copy than a slipped copy, because obviously the costs to ship it won't be worth the trouble; but if you know, based on precedent, that a certain type of slip is going to probably sell for the same amount of money as the entire original release did (or even more), it seems kinda strange to knowingly throw easy money away just to prove a point about "lol cardboard." Especially since the very people who you might scoff at for being so picky about that cardboard will be the very people paying you $30 for it in two years...or six months. Multiply that out with the total numbers of titles you collect, and you could have a cool couple hundreds that wouldn't have been there otherwise. I mean, I really don't care about my digital codes and probably have the same mindset about them as people who dislike slips have about slips; the only difference is that instead of throwing my digital codes in the trash, I just sold a batch of them for $50, with which I can either consider them rebates on the titles I bought initially, or I can use the money to get a few new releases or a Zavvi LE release essentially for free, with the costs covered by the digital code buyers.

Then again, maybe I'm just a boring, soulless capitalist for not throwing away easy money I can get from people whose interests I acknowledge but don't really understand, and invest that money into my own interests.
